Learning Support Assistant - Year 2 ASD

Location: Lambeth, South London

Start Date: 21st September 2026

Contract: Full-time, long-term

Pay: £100-£120 per day

A welcoming Lambeth primary school is looking for a dedicated Learning Support Assistant to provide 1:1 support to a Year 2 pupil with Autism (ASD).

The pupil is currently showing challenging behaviour and a strong reluctance to attend and engage with school. The successful Learning Support Assistant will therefore play a key role in building trust, reducing anxiety and helping the pupil gradually develop a more positive relationship with school.

The Role

Working closely with the class teacher, SENCO and wider pastoral team, you will provide consistent and individualised support throughout the school day.

Your responsibilities will include:

Providing dedicated 1:1 support for a Year 2 pupil with ASD

Building a trusting and positive relationship with the pupil

Supporting emotional regulation and managing challenging behaviour

Helping the pupil settle into classroom routines and school life

Encouraging engagement with learning and activities

Supporting transitions and reducing anxiety around the school environment

Developing the pupil's communication, social skills and independence

Adapting activities and expectations according to the pupil's needs

Working closely with the SENCO, class teacher and parents/carers

About You

The school is looking for a Learning Support Assistant who is patient, resilient and able to remain calm and consistent when faced with challenging behaviour.

Previous experience supporting children with ASD, challenging behaviour, SEMH or school avoidance would be highly desirable. Most importantly, you will understand that building a strong relationship and creating a sense of safety and trust will be central to helping this pupil make progress.

This role would suit an experienced SEN Teaching Assistant, Learning Support Assistant or Behaviour Support Assistant who is looking for a rewarding long-term opportunity.
